Answer:
The maximum height obtained by the object is approximately 31.855 m
Step-by-step explanation:
The vertical velocity of the object = 25.0 m/s
The height reached by the object, is given by the following formula;
v² = u² - 2 × g × h
Where;
u = The initial velocity of the object = 25.0 m/s
v = The final speed of the object = 0 m/s at maximum height
h = The maximum height obtained by the object
g = The acceleration due to gravity = 9.81 m/s²
Substituting the values, gives;
0² = (25.0 m/s)² - 2 × 9.81 m/s² × h
2 × 9.81 m/s² × h = (25.0 m/s)²
h = (25.0 m/s)²/(2 × 9.81 m/s²) ≈ 31.855 m
The maximum height obtained by the object, h ≈ 31.855 m.
